หน้า 1 จากทั้งหมด 1

คำสั่งดู Port, Process ID และ Program ที่เกี่ยวข้อง

โพสต์โพสต์แล้ว: 10 ธ.ค. 2021 09:57
โดย nuiz
ไม่ได้ลงบทความในหัวข้อ CentOS มานานเลย

ตามปกติเวลาผมจะดูว่าบนเครื่องตอนนี้มี Port ไหนเปิดอยู่บ้าง ผมก็จะใช้คำสั่ง netstat -ln ตลอดเลยครับ ถ้า Program ทำงานอยู่ ก็จะเห็น Port เปิดอยู่ ถ้าไม่ทำงานก็ไม่เห็น แต่ก็ไม่รู้ว่า Program ไหนที่มันใช้งาน Port นั้นอยู่ จะรู้เฉพาะโปรแกรมหลักๆที่มันจะมี Default Port เช่น MySQL 3306, Asterisk 5060, httpd 443, sshd 22 เป็นต้น

พอเห็น Port แปลกๆไม่คุ้น ถ้าอยากรู้ว่า Program ไหนใช้ ก็คำสั่ง netstat เหมือนเดิมครับ แต่ให้เพิ่ม -p เข้าไปด้วย แบบนี้

โค้ด: เลือกทั้งหมด
netstat -lpn


ตามตัวอย่างในรูปเลยครับ ชื่อโปรแกรมจะอยู่คอลัมน์ขวามือสุด

รูปภาพ

เทคนิคการใช้งาน Issabel
เทคนิคการใช้งาน Elastix
เทคนิคการใช้งาน Asterisk
เทคนิคการใช้งาน FreePBX
เทคนิคการคอนฟิก Elastix/Issabel ให้ทำงานเป็น Time Server
เทคนิคการใช้งาน Issabel.Video โดยไม่ต้องใช้หรือไม่ต้องมี Issabel
เทคนิคการใช้งาน Caller ID Lookup Sources จาก MySQL
เทคนิคการใช้งาน Caller ID Lookup Sources จาก Internal Phonebooks
ตัวอย่างการใช้งาน Action URL บน Grandstream IP Phone
รวมเทคนิคการใช้งาน Mikrotik RouterOS/Router Board
เทคนิคการติดตั้ง Asterisk 17.x + DAHDI 3.1.0 บน CentOS 7
เทคนิคการใช้งานคำสั่ง NoCDR ใน Asterisk Dial Plan